An armchair discovery tour of truly remarkable places, captured in SJ Axelby’s inimitable watercolours. This follow-up volume to SJ Axelby’s Interior Portraits transports the reader to bars, cafes, museums, shops, hotels, tearooms, restaurants, gardens, trains and more, around the world.
This is an insider’s guide to the classic, the cool and the quirky, with locations around the world hand-picked by SJ and painted in her trademark bright and detailed watercolours. All the featured places have something special, whether that’s a stunning position, centuries of history, designer interiors or a touch of good old-fashioned glamour.
The text offers the reader intriguing details and insider knowledge about the history and design of these locations, plus there’s also the occasional cocktail recipe! Curated by an artist with an appreciation of the fine details, SJ Axelby’s Painted Travels is a taste-filled tour to delight and inspire the reader.
A small selection of the c.60 destinations that are featured in the book:
- HR Giger Bar, Gruyères, Switzerland (immersive artwork and bar in one)
- Populart, Seville (selling new and historic ceramics including azulejos tiles)
- The San Domenico Palace Hotel in Taormina, Sicily (setting for season 2 of The White Lotus)
- Woodman’s Hut, Scottish Highlands (dark-sky eco hideaway)
- Chatsworth House (Derbyshire’s most beautiful country house)
- Parker Palm Springs (Hollywood insiders’ escape)
- UK leg of the Venice Simpson Orient Express (Golden Age restored train including carriage designed by Wes Anderson)
- Liberty London (iconic department store)
- Petersham Nurseries (unique plant nursery and lifestyle venue)

About the Author
SJ Axelby has had a paintbrush in her hand for as long as she can remember. She has a degree in textile design and loves pattern, colour and all things interiors. Best known for her room portraiture (she created the Room Portrait Club during lockdown), recent clients include Christie's, Kit Kemp and Alexandra Tolstoy. Her work has featured in the Telegraph Stella Magazine, FT How to Spend It, the Liberty Book, Elle Decoration and The World of Interiors and international titles such as Elle Decor Italia and Architectural Digest.
